We are looking to recruit outstanding fresh Java Developers who will receive intensive training in Java Development. After training, they will be involved in designing and implementing server-side components of software products as part of a team developing financial services using cutting-edge technologies.
Responsibilities:
- Develop simple web-based Java Applications and Components
- Compile, debug and run Java Applications
- Implement functional changes, enhancements, and customization to meet business and technical requirements
- Act positively and respond promptly to changes in work environment and development approaches
- Perform other job-related duties incidental to the work
Requirements:
- BSc degree in Computer Science, Computer Information Systems or related field
- Fresh graduates - up to one year of experience
- Good Core Java Programming skills
- Good Object-Oriented Programming understanding
- Good knowledge of IDEs (e.g. Eclipse, Netbeans, Intellij) for running and debugging Java programs
- Good knowledge and understanding of Database components and concepts
- Minimal knowledge of J2EE (Servlet, JSP), JPA, Hibernate, Tomcat and Spring
- Knowledge of front-end technologies like HTML, Javascript and CSS is a plus
- Self-motivated, self-learner, hard-worker and team-player
- Ability to investigate new technologies and create proofs-of-concept if necessary
- Committed to work and willing to travel abroad
- Good written and verbal communication skills
This role offers an excellent opportunity for fresh graduates to start their career in Java development and gain hands-on experience with cutting-edge technologies in the financial services sector. Join ProgressSoft to be part of an innovative team and grow your skills in a dynamic environment.